Output ef5336daca1acc0d5744085592e3bac7afc672e3700ccf6714a54dab53ac8e50:1

value
640723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6c04190bc1fb4fc66732bb1b7653cbe153ea4f9 OP_EQUALVERIFY OP_CHECKSIG
address
LdLrNPFcqFhyhrvMEcH59QPrfQennBmciZ
transaction
ef5336daca1acc0d5744085592e3bac7afc672e3700ccf6714a54dab53ac8e50
spent
true